Memphis in May reports record $3.48 million loss
The attendance of 37,805 at Beale Street Music Festival, according to the report, was the lowest in more than 30 years. (Ziggy Mack/Special to. The Daily Memphian file)
Attendance figures for the Beale Street Music Festival hit a 30-year low, according to the report released Tuesday, Oct. 3. The festival’s annual report promises further word on the 2024 festival’s future in the coming days.
